Key Elements of a Contra Costa California Correspondent Agreement — Self-Employed Independent Contractor— - Scope of Services: This agreement clearly defines the services the correspondent will provide as an independent contractor. It should outline the correspondent's responsibilities, schedule, and deliverables. — Payment Terms: The agreement should include details about the correspondent's compensation, such as the payment structure, rates, and frequency of payment. It may also mention any additional expenses or reimbursements. — Intellectual Property: This section ensures that the correspondent understands that any intellectual property rights arising from their work will belong to the client. — Confidentiality and Non-Disclosure: To protect sensitive information, a confidentiality clause may be included, restricting the correspondent from sharing or using confidential information without prior consent. — Termination Clause: This covers the circumstances under which either party can terminate the agreement, including any notice periods or other requirements. — Indemnification: This clause holds the correspondent accountable for any damages, claims, or liabilities arising out of their work or actions as an independent contractor. — Governing Law: The agreement should specify that it is governed by the laws of Contra Costa County, California, ensuring that any legal disputes will be resolved in accordance with local jurisdiction. 2. Types of Contra Costa California Correspondent Agreement — Self-Employed Independent Contractor— - Media Correspondent Agreement: This type of agreement is specifically tailored for correspondents working in the media industry, such as journalists, reporters, or photographers. It may include provisions for exclusive rights, content syndication, and copyright ownership. — Freelance Correspondent Agreement: This type of agreement is generally used when a correspondent offers their services to multiple clients on a project-by-project basis. — Marketing Correspondent Agreement: This type of agreement is designed for correspondents involved in marketing and promotional activities. It may address topics like brand guidelines, content creation, and promotional strategies.
